是一个常见的前端开发问题。在这种情况下,由于两个div具有相同的ID,会导致HTML文档无效。为了解决这个问题,可以使用以下方法:
- 修改ID:将两个div的ID修改为不同的值,确保每个元素都有唯一的ID。这样,菜单导航链接可以分别指向这两个不同的ID。
- 使用class:将两个div的ID修改为相同的class,而不是ID。然后,通过JavaScript或CSS选择器来选择这些元素。菜单导航链接可以使用class选择器来导航到相应的div。
- 使用data属性:在菜单导航链接中使用data属性来存储目标div的ID或其他标识符。然后,通过JavaScript来获取data属性的值,并根据该值找到相应的div。
- 使用JavaScript事件处理程序:通过JavaScript事件处理程序来处理菜单导航链接的点击事件。在事件处理程序中,根据链接的特定属性或其他标识符,找到相应的div并进行操作。
无论使用哪种方法,都需要确保代码的可维护性和可扩展性。以下是一些腾讯云相关产品和产品介绍链接,可以帮助您更好地理解和实现这个问题:
请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估。